Several factors are significantly driving the growth of the construction glass curtain wall market. Firstly, rapid urbanization globally is leading to a surge in construction activities, particularly in developing economies, resulting in a substantial demand for modern and aesthetically appealing building facades. Secondly, the increasing preference for energy-efficient buildings is fueling the demand for high-performance glass curtain wall systems that offer superior insulation, reducing energy consumption and operational costs. Thirdly, advancements in glass technology, including the development of self-cleaning, smart, and solar control glass, are broadening the applications and enhancing the functionality of glass curtain walls. These advancements allow for improved natural lighting, reduced glare, and better thermal performance, which are highly desirable features in modern buildings. Fourthly, the construction industry is adopting innovative and efficient construction methods, such as prefabrication and modular construction, to accelerate project completion and reduce costs. This trend is particularly relevant for the installation of glass curtain walls, optimizing the construction process. Finally, government initiatives promoting sustainable building practices and stringent building codes are incentivizing the use of energy-efficient and environmentally friendly building materials, including advanced glass curtain wall systems. These factors combined are creating a strong impetus for continued market growth in the coming years.
Despite the promising outlook, the construction glass curtain wall market faces certain challenges. One significant constraint is the high initial investment cost associated with installing glass curtain wall systems, particularly for advanced types incorporating sophisticated features like smart glass or self-cleaning coatings. This can be a deterrent for smaller projects or developers with limited budgets. Furthermore, the complexity of installation and the need for skilled labor can pose challenges, particularly in regions with a shortage of trained professionals. The risk of damage during transportation and installation is also a concern, necessitating robust handling procedures and skilled installation crews to minimize potential losses and project delays. Another factor is the susceptibility of glass curtain walls to damage from extreme weather conditions, requiring the use of robust and durable materials capable of withstanding environmental stressors. Finally, fluctuating raw material prices and supply chain disruptions can impact the overall cost and availability of construction glass curtain wall systems. Addressing these challenges requires collaborative efforts among manufacturers, contractors, and policymakers to develop cost-effective solutions, improve installation techniques, and ensure a stable supply chain.
